Texas Code § 8.122

INCENTIVE FUNDING FOR DISTRICT EFFICIENCIES

Sec. 8.122. INCENTIVE FUNDING FOR DISTRICT EFFICIENCIES. (a) The legislature may appropriate money from the foundation school fund to establish an incentive fund to encourage efficiency in the provision of services by the system of regional education service centers.
(b) The commissioner may submit to each regular session of the legislature an incentive funding report and plan that:
(1) demonstrates that regional education service centers are providing the services required or permitted by law;
(2) defines efficiencies of scale in measurable terms;
(3) proposes the size of and payment schedule for the incentive fund; and
(4) establishes a method for documenting and computing efficiencies.
(c) The commissioner shall determine the method by which money appropriated under this section is distributed to regional education service centers.
(d) The board of trustees of a school district may delegate purchasing or other administrative functions to a regional education service center to the extent necessary to achieve efficiencies under this section.
